Unit dose packaging (ويسمى أيضا single-dose packaging) means each dose of medication is individually sealed in its own package. على سبيل المثال, one pill might be in its own blister pocket or pouch. Jinlu Packing explains that “unit dose packaging means each individual dose of a medication is pre-packaged and sealed by itself”. في الممارسة العملية, this can be a single-tablet blister card, حزمة الشريط (one tablet per cavity), a prefilled syringe, a vial, or a sachet containing one dose of liquid or powder. Each package carries labels (اسم الدواء, جرعة, expiration) so a nurse or patient can confirm the medicine without counting pills from a bottle. In US hospitals, زيادة 75% of oral meds are dispensed in unit-dose form.

Unit-dose packs are common in المستشفيات, عيادات, long-term care facilities, and clinical trials – essentially anywhere precise dose control and traceability are paramount. They help prevent dosing errors because each packet contains exactly one dose and is clearly labeled. بعبارة أخرى, as Jinlu notes, unit-dose packs require no counting – you “just grab one package and open it”, reducing handling mistakes. في المقابل, bulk packaging refers to multi-dose or collective packaging of drugs. Common bulk formats include large pill bottles, الجرار, multi-dose tubes, and bulk bags or totes. على سبيل المثال, a 100-tablet prescription bottle or a vitamin jar with 30 capsules is bulk packaging. These containers hold many doses together. Bulk packaging is the norm for consumer pharmacy products, أدوية دون وصفة طبية, المكملات الغذائية, and most generic tablets. It’s also used for intermediate stages of production (على سبيل المثال. bulk sachets or drums).

Bulk packaging is usually more cost-effective per dose and is suited to high-volume, commodity products. The equipment for bulk lines includes tablet/capsule counting and bottle filling machines, السد, ختم, and labeling equipment. على سبيل المثال, a tablet-counting line may use an automatic counting machine to fill bottles, a capper to seal them, and a labeler to finish. Bulk lines often run faster (counting hundreds of tablets per minute) but offer less dose-by-dose control than unit-dose systems. Bulk packaging is ideal for mass-market OTC drugs, المكملات الغذائية, generic medications, and any product where price per dose is critical and individual dosing control is less important.
The table below compares the two approaches on important factors:
| عامل | تعبئة جرعة الوحدة | التعبئة والتغليف السائبة |
| Medication Safety | عالي. Each dose sealed, reducing contamination. | أدنى. Multiple doses in one container. |
| امتثال المريض | أحسن. Individual doses clearly labeled; easier to verify. | أدنى. Patients count their own doses. |
| إمكانية التتبع & التسلسل | ممتاز. Easy to serialize/track each dose. | محدود. Only container is tracked, not each pill. |
| Packaging Cost | Higher per dose. More packaging material & التعامل مع. | Lower per dose. One package holds many units. |
| Production Throughput | معتدل. More steps per dose (على سبيل المثال. تشكيل نفطة). | أعلى. Simple counting/filling is faster. |
| Packaging Waste | أكثر. One-dose packs increase material use. | أقل. Minimal packaging per dose (على سبيل المثال. one bottle vs. 100 بثور). |
| Shelf-life/Protection | أحسن. Blisters/vials often have high-barrier films. | معتدل. Bulk bottles protect less per unit, though shelf life can be similar. |
| أفضل ل | Hospitals, التجارب السريرية, high-value drugs, controlled substances, personalized meds. | Retail OTC, generic drugs, الفيتامينات, المكملات الغذائية, large-volume consumer products. |
As Jinlu Packing notes, think of it like a bottle of 100 أقراص (حجم كبير) versus a blister with one tablet (unit dose). Bulk bottles clearly win on cost efficiency and speed, but unit-dose formats excel on safety and control. على سبيل المثال, blister packaging individually protects each pill from moisture and tampering, whereas bulk bottles expose all tablets to the same environment.

Different end-markets and use-cases have clear preferences. The table below summarizes typical industry choices:
| Industry/Use Case | Preferred Packaging |
| Hospitals & الرعاية الصحية (acute care) | Unit Dose (بثور, شرائط, المحاقن) |
| Long-Term Care & LTC Pharmacy | Unit Dose (بطاقات نفطة, pre-filled packs) |
| Clinical Trials & بحث | Unit Dose (precise dosage control for trials) |
| High-Potency / Controlled Substances | Unit Dose (security, الجرعات) |
| Contract Manufacturing (CMOs producing hospital meds) | Unit Dose |
| Over-the-Counter (خارج البورصة) المخدرات | Bulk (bottles/tubes of tablets, كبسولات) |
| المغذيات & المكملات الغذائية | Bulk (vitamin bottles, أكياس) |
| Generic Pharmaceuticals (mass market) | Bulk (cost focus) |
| Emerging Consumer Health (مستحضرات التجميل, nutraceutical combos) | Bulk |
| Veterinary / Animal Health | Bulk (often retail multi-dose vials or feed additives) |
| Emergency Kits / First Aid | Unit Dose (single-use pouches for portability) |
على سبيل المثال, Jinlu notes that unit-dose systems originated in hospitals and now “vastly expanded” into other fields due to safety advantages. بالفعل, زيادة 75% of U.S. hospital oral medications are unit-dosed, reflecting the sector’s preference. في المقابل, consumer-facing markets like supplements and OTC pain relievers typically use bulk containers because they demand lower unit cost and higher volume. Clinical and hospital environments favor the dosing control of blisters or sachets, while generic-drug manufacturers and retailers focus on the efficiency of bottle lines.

Bulk lines use equipment optimized for speed and volume:
في الواقع, أ bulk packaging line typically looks like: Bottle unscrambler → Tablet counter filling machine → Desiccant inserter → Capper → (Foil sealer) → Labeler → Cartoner. These modular machines can also handle diverse products (غومينز, مساحيق, السوائل) as long as counting/filling and capping are adjusted. Jinlu’s and pages illustrate how such lines are integrated.
على سبيل المثال, the JL-16R gummy line “automatically complete the entire process of unscramble bottles, counting … inserting desiccant, السد, aluminum foil sealing and labeling” at حتى 80 زجاجات / دقيقة. These advanced lines emphasize throughput and consistency, making them ideal for bulk product packaging.

لا توجد إجابة واحدة تناسب الجميع. The choice between unit dose and bulk packaging depends on your product’s requirements and your business strategy. Unit-dose packaging offers unmatched safety, امتثال, and convenience for hospitals, التجارب السريرية, and high-value drugs, but it requires more investment in machinery (blister or sachet packers, عمال التعبئة والتغليف) ومواد التعبئة والتغليف. Bulk packaging (زجاجات, الجرار, أنابيب) excels at low cost and high throughput, ideal for retail drugs and supplements, but gives less control over individual dosing.
في الممارسة العملية, many companies use كلاهما methods for different products. على سبيل المثال, a drug with a narrow therapeutic index might be packed in single-dose blisters for hospital sale, while the same medication’s OTC version is sold in 30-count bottles. When designing your line, النظر في التكلفة الإجمالية للملكية (معدات + مواد + errors) and regulatory needs.
To determine the best approach, review the factors above: target market, شكل الجرعة, مقدار, compliance rules, والميزانية.
